Around the World

Distance between Thai Charoen and Xianshuigu

Distance from Thai Charoen to Xianshuigu is 1766 miles / 2843 kilometers.

Map showing the distance from Thai Charoen to Xianshuigu

Beeline Air distance: miles km

Thai Charoen

City: Thai Charoen
Country: Thailand
Coordinates: 16°3′59″N
104°26′24″E

Xianshuigu

City: Xianshuigu
Country: China
Coordinates: 38°59′6″N
117°22′58″E

Time difference between Thai Charoen and Xianshuigu

The time difference between Thai Charoen and Xianshuigu is 1 hour. Xianshuigu is 1 hour ahead of Thai Charoen. Current local time in Thai Charoen is 19:53 +07 (2025-01-08) and time in Xianshuigu is 20:53 CST (2025-01-08).

Search